Kodi (formerly XBMC) is a free and open source media player application developed by the XBMC/Kodi Foundation a non-profit technology consortium. Kodi is available for multiple operating-systems and hardware platforms featuring a 10-foot user interface for use with televisions and remote controls.
Regardless of whether you are using Chorus2 or Arch as your Kodi web interface you should always protect this interface by creating your own username and password from within Kodi's Services → Control menu. If you don't password-protect this interface your Kodi controls will be on the Internet for anyone in the world to access.
SMB is available on all Windows computers and can be easily setup by the home user. SMB can also be accessed by other operating systems which makes SMB the most commonly used network protocol to access content on a NAS or other remote hardware. Note: SMB v1 is not supported in Kodi. SMB v2 or higher must be used.

By default Kodi users a profile called Master User because the majority of media center users only need a single profile. There is no login required for this account and Kodi will login to this automatically on startup. For multi user setup on Kodi we need to 1) enable logons and 2) define our users.

A profile.xml file exists after the very first installation of Kodi at its userdata-folder and unless you have created additional profiles it won't have any other information as for the Master user (Kodis default user). If you create other/additional profiles that file will be populated with additional informations about the created profile.
